History

LaLiga Santander is the official name of the Campeonato Nacional de Liga de Primera División. La Liga was established in 1928 by José María Acha following the need of a national league in Spain. Barcelona won the very first Liga in 1929.

La Liga has been the best league in Europe for seven consecutive years, according to UEFA’s league coefficient rankings. La Liga has the most UEFA Champions League (18), UEFA Europa League (12), UEFA Super Cup (15), and FIFA Club World Cup (7) titles, and its players have the most Ballon d’Or awards (7). (23)

Format

During the establishment, the number of teams was 10, which gradually increased over time. Right now, in season 20 teams participate and play in a double round-robin format where each team faces all their opponents twice, in the home and away games. A total of 38 games are played, and they rank based on total points, goal differential and goals scored are used to rate teams. Teams are considered to be in the same place if they are all equal. A play-off match at a neutral site determines rank if there is a tie for the title, promotion, or qualification to other competitions.

Real Madrid and Barcelona are the most successful team who have won 34 times and 26 times respectively.

Top Teams

Barcelona was the inaugural champion in 1929, while Real Madrid won their first championship in 1932.

Atletico Madrid, Athletic Bilbao and Valencia are some of the other big contenders who have dominated in their share of time.

Teams No of Titles

Real Madrid 34

Barcelona 26

Atlético Madrid 10

Athletic Bilbao 8

Valencia 6

Real Sociedad 2

Deportivo La Coruña. 1

Sevilla. 1

Real Betis. 1

League Records

Andoni Zubizarreta has the highest number of appearances(622) in La Liga

Lionel Messi is the all-time top scorer with 469 goals in 514 appearances.

Philippe Coutinho holds the record of the highest transfer fee with £145 Million.

Lionel Messi has won the highest no of golden boots(6).

Iker Casillas and Víctor Valdés jointly hold the record of most no golden gloves in league awards (2).

Top Rivalries

Real Madrid VS Barcelona

El Clasico, also known as The Classic, is regarded as the most important match in club football history. Since their inception, Barcelona and Real Madrid have been bitter rivals. Their rivalry dates back to the Spanish Civil War at the city level. Both the teams have dominated world football for a fair share of time, and their star players Cristiano Ronaldo and Lionel Messi have been part of the World’s Greatest Footballer debate. Real Madrid and Barcelona are the two teams with the world’s biggest fan base, and this sparks the game to a new level. Real Madrid won the last fixture 3-1.

Real Madrid VS Atletico Madrid

The match between Atletico de Madrid and Real Madrid is considered the Madrid Derby. The rivalry between the two clubs dates back to the early twentieth century. Atletico Madrid stood in the way of Real Madrid’s ambitions to establish themselves as the capital’s strongest team. It is the second biggest match in Spanish football, and in the 21’st century, after the growth of Atletico’s fan base, the derby madness has been a worldwide phenomenon.

La Liga 19-20

Barcelona were the two-time defending champions at the start of the season, but things didn’t go well for them. Real Madrid won a historic 34th league title on July 16th, with one match remaining, after defeating Villarreal.

The top 3 teams were

Name of Teams. Points

Real Madrid. 87

Barcelona 82

Atlético Madrid 70

Teams Relegated
Leganés
Mallorca
Espanyol

Teams Promoted
Huesca
Cádiz
Elche
